1. Detail the steps you take when balancing a cash drawer at the end of a shift.

Balancing a cash drawer reflects your meticulousness and ability to handle financial responsibilities under pressure. In a casino environment, where large sums of money are exchanged rapidly, accuracy and accountability are paramount. This question delves into your methodical approach to ensuring every transaction is accounted for, impacting the casino’s financial integrity and your credibility. Demonstrating a clear, consistent process reassures the interviewer that you can be trusted with the casino’s assets and possess the attention to detail necessary to mitigate errors and discrepancies.

How to Answer: When responding, describe your process step-by-step, emphasizing precision and consistency. Start by organizing all transactional documents and receipts before counting the cash. Explain how you systematically count and double-check the cash, ensuring it matches the recorded transactions. Highlight any tools or software you use to assist in this process and how you handle discrepancies, including documenting and reporting them promptly. Conclude by emphasizing the final verification step and how you secure the cash and documents, readying them for the next shift.

Example: “At the end of my shift, I start by closing out any open transactions and ensuring the cash drawer is locked. I then count and record the total amount of cash, chips, and other forms of currency in the drawer, comparing it against the initial starting balance and the records of transactions made during my shift. I make sure to double-count everything to avoid any discrepancies.

If I do find a discrepancy, I immediately review each transaction and cross-reference it with the receipts and records to pinpoint where the error might have occurred. Once everything balances, I fill out the necessary reports and log all the figures into the system. Finally, I secure the cash drawer and hand it over to the next cashier or to the vault, depending on the protocol. This process ensures accuracy and accountability, which is crucial in a high-stakes environment like a casino.”

5. Walk me through the process of verifying and processing chips from different gaming tables.

Understanding the process of verifying and processing chips from different gaming tables directly impacts the financial integrity and operational efficiency of the casino. This question delves into your familiarity with the detailed procedures and protocols that ensure accuracy and accountability. It also explores your ability to manage high-stress situations where precision and speed are equally important. Additionally, your response can shed light on your knowledge of security measures, compliance with regulations, and the importance of maintaining an audit trail.

How to Answer: Clearly outline each step of the process, from receiving chips to verifying their authenticity and value, recording the transaction, and securely storing the chips. Highlight any tools or software you use, such as counting machines or databases, and explain how you ensure accuracy at each stage. Mention any specific protocols for dealing with discrepancies and emphasize your commitment to following established procedures.

Example: “First, I’d collect the chips from the gaming tables, making sure to secure them in a locked container for transport. Once back at the cage, I’d use the chip counting machine to quickly and accurately tally the chips from each table, separating them by denomination.

After obtaining the machine count, I’d manually verify the totals to ensure there are no discrepancies. For added accuracy, I’d cross-reference these figures with the table’s records from the pit boss. Once everything aligns, I’d input the totals into our system, double-checking for any errors. Lastly, I’d prepare a detailed report and securely store the chips in the vault, ensuring proper documentation and adherence to regulatory standards.”

14. How would you handle the detection of a counterfeit bill?

Handling counterfeit bills is a significant aspect of the role, as it directly impacts the financial integrity of the establishment. Detecting counterfeit currency requires meticulous attention to detail and a strong understanding of security protocols. This question delves into your ability to remain vigilant and adhere to established procedures under pressure. It also examines your knowledge of the tools and techniques used to identify counterfeit bills, such as UV lights, magnifying glasses, and security features embedded in bills. Beyond technical skills, it assesses your ability to stay calm and composed, as well as your decision-making process when faced with potential fraud.

How to Answer: Emphasize your familiarity with the specific tools and techniques used to detect counterfeit bills, as well as any relevant training or experience you have. Describe a systematic approach to handling such situations, including verifying the bill, documenting the incident, and following the appropriate reporting and escalation procedures. Highlight your ability to maintain composure and professionalism.

Example: “First, I’d remain calm and discreet to avoid causing any alarm among customers. I’d double-check the bill using the counterfeit detection tools provided, such as UV lights or pens, to confirm my suspicion. If it’s indeed counterfeit, I’d follow our protocol by notifying my supervisor immediately while keeping the bill separate from the rest of the cash.

Then, I’d document the incident as per company policy, including details about the customer and the transaction, and hand over the counterfeit bill to my supervisor or security team. Throughout the process, I’d ensure the customer is treated respectfully and discreetly, as they might not be aware that the bill is fake. This way, we maintain a professional and secure environment while addressing the situation appropriately.”
